Facilities Ticket — Mail Room Relocation, Dorrance Building. The mail room moves from Ground Floor East to Basement Level 1, Room B-14, effective Monday. Visiting contractors from Halbert Fit-Out should use the service corridor only and keep trolleys off the main lobby. All crates must be labelled before transit. Access to B-14 requires the temporary pass code shown below.

staff pass of kawip-hawef = bdg-QLP-2

### Changed defaults: config hot-reload

Quick note for the sync: Thornbeam now hot-reloads config by default instead of requiring a restart. The watcher polls every 15 seconds, and invalid files are rejected with the last good config kept in memory — no more mystery crashes from a half-saved YAML. If you were relying on restart-to-apply, update your deploy scripts. New defaults below.

service settings:
novath:
  pin: 1396
  tenant: pelys
  seal: seal_ccc035e1
  metrics_host: metrics.novath.qorvelworks.test
  standby_team: fraeth
  escalation: drueth-zorok
  nonce: 61d508

14:22 — Offline sync regression confirmed (Terrapath field-survey app)

At 14:22 the on-call engineer reproduced the data-loss path: surveys saved while offline were marked synced once connectivity returned, even when the upload was rejected. The queue flush skipped the server acknowledgement check introduced in the previous sprint. Release manager note: the fix must ship before the coastal survey season. The offending build is identified by the token recorded below.

session token of kawif-fawig = htk31_f3f599be2b1a34affb1efa8d0feccf8